TURN-208: Gatevale turnstile counters at the Merrow Field pilot double-count when a rotation reverses mid-cycle. Attendance totals drift roughly 2% high per event. The debounce window fix is implemented, reviewed by Ilsa, and soak-tested across two simulated match days without drift. Ready for your cut; the candidate build is identified below.

trace token, tagag-tafog: htk6_5ed18c

### Key Ceremony Checklist — Item 7: FX Rounding Verification

Before signing the Coinwright release, confirm the currency-conversion module rounds at final display only, using banker's rounding, and that ledger totals reconcile to the cent across all supported currencies. Attach the reconciliation report to the ceremony record. Once verified, unseal the signing token with the recovery passphrase below.

unlock words, yawig-kagef: gordor-holvan-ulaael-pramir-ulaiel-tamdor

## Releases

Purgewell, our data-retention sweeper, ships on a fixed monthly cadence because deletions are irreversible. Each release is cut from a tagged commit, built in the isolated pipeline, and run against the retention-policy test corpus before promotion. Please never deploy an unsigned build, even to staging — the sweeper refuses to start without a valid signature, and bypassing that check is a fireable-level mistake. All release artifacts are verified against this key:

deploy key for bafof-bahaf: bky3_Sjg